Designing And Implementing Of GIS Spatial Data Management System Based On ArcSDE

Spatial data is the core of GIS. Many present spatial data management systems are usually only attached importance to storing and managing graphical data and attribute data of GIS in RDBMS. The graphical data in RDBMS is stored and managed as files , the attribute data is stored and managed as RDBMS. This GIS spatial data management system based on RDBMS is not satisfied to the demands for users to inquire about a lot of important graphical data in GIS, is not hold out for many users to seek it at the same time , and is not satisfied the network sharing development. This paper has designed and developed the GIS spatial data management system based oriented object in structure C/S under related techniques about spatial database and components GIS, as spatial database platform of Oracle, and as engine of ArcSDE, this system has realized the effective arrangement, safe storing, distributed service of GIS in order to provide the effective solution for GIS spatial data arrangement and management.Using Oracle 10g as the back database and second development components based on ArcSDE as the logical median components , using ArcEngine and its usual attributes, methods and events, under .NET development environment, with C# language, the GIS spatial data management system, that has the perfect spatial data process, spatial analyst functions and entire visualization tools, is developed in this paper.Using UML and Rational Rose model tools, applying to object oriented modeling techniques, the total design and detail design of this system is described in this paper. The static requirement models, the dynamic requirement models, the static object models and the dynamic object models are built up, the dispose diagrams, the component diagrams, use-case diagrams, the class diagrams, the object diagrams, the sequence diagrams, the combine diagrams, the state diagrams and the activity diagrams are designed, then the programming structure, the software interfaces and the programming technological processes of this system are also designed in this paper. This paper uses spatial database techniques based on oriented object, designs 1:10000 Harbin spatial database structure and attribute database structure, and realizes the GIS complex operation function, for example, inputting, editing, inquiring, analysis, input-database and renewing GIS spatial data, attribute data, image data and so on. Using the integrated storing techniques of spatial data based on ArcSDE, storing GIS spatial data and image data in the BLOB type field of Oracle database, using integrated showing of drawing and writing, this system realizes the function integrated storing, managing and showing the graphical data(DLG data), the attribute data and the image data(DOM data). This system integrates together GIS graphical ,attribute and image data, realizes GIS data integration and sharing from many resources, is beneficial to the development, application and integration of GIS spatial data, so that advantages of GIS spatial database is fully used. It solves the question about the integration techniques of spatial and attributes data by GIS in order to provide possible technological solution to the development and application of GIS spatial data management system.
